"A landing Cessna 150 collided with a hovering Pennsylvania State Police Bell 407 helicopter at Carlisle Airport in Pennsylvania on August 19, 2026. The crash killed the pilot of the small plane, 57-year-old Dr. Paul Sokoloski, and injured the two state troopers aboard the helicopter.Crash DetailsDate and Time: August 19, 2026, at approximately 6:52 p.m.Location: Carlisle Airport, a small uncontrolled airfield in Pennsylvania.Aircraft Involved: A fixed-wing Cessna 150 and a state police Bell 407 helicopter.Casualties: The Cessna pilot was killed; two troopers (Cpl. Bryce Corman and Trooper Jason Mills) sustained injuries but survived.What HappenedThe state police helicopter was conducting a routine training exercise and hovering over a grassy area adjacent to the runway.The Cessna 150 approached for landing, but for reasons still under investigation, veered sharply to the right and struck the helicopter's tail rotor before hitting the main rotor.The impact destroyed the helicopter's tail boom and blades, causing it to roll onto its side/roof, while the small plane broke apart.Ongoing InvestigationBoth the National Transportation Safety Board (NTSB) and the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) launched full investigations.Investigators are analyzing recovery data cards, witness accounts, maintenance background of the Cessna, and video footage to determine why the plane made the unexpected turn.Watch this update from investigators explaining the context and physical evidence surrounding the collision:57sNTSB investigators share update on investigation into crash at Carlisle ...22K views · 2 days agoYouTube · NBC10 PhiladelphiaWould you like to know more about the NTSB preliminary findings or the safety protocols for mixed aircraft operations at uncontrolled airports?YouTube·Taking OffCessna Hits PA State Police Helicopter at Carlisle Airport - YouTubeAug 20, 2026 — NTSB and FAA investigators are on scene, with a preliminary report expected soon.
